B. Monetization & Advertising
- The Industry Standard: Top-tier hosts use non-intrusive display ads or premium subscriptions. Aggressive pop-ups and pop-unders are increasingly rare on reputable sites because they trigger antivirus warnings and ad-blockers.
- FreeForFile Status: Like many secondary file hosts, the site relies heavily on aggressive ad networks to cover server costs. This often includes pop-ups or redirect loops.
- Verdict: Poor. While monetization is necessary, aggressive ads degrade trust. Users often associate high volumes of pop-ups with malware risk, driving them toward safer alternatives.

Executive Summary
FreeForFile.com operates within the crowded "cyberlocker" and file-hosting niche. In an ecosystem dominated by giants like Google Drive, Mega, and MediaFire, niche sites must offer specific value propositions—such as higher speed limits for free users, less intrusive advertising, or specialized content—to survive.
